My engine is a 66 389+.030 65 stock tripower...

My engine is a 66 389+.030
65 stock tripower intake and correct Carbs.( slightly modified per Dick Boneske)
2 1/2" X pipe system from PYPES
Flat top pistons
Stock #77 heads

Absolutely agree. Condensation is a problem,...

Absolutely agree. Condensation is a problem, especially if you have an air condition garage . The cool air in the garage will speed up the issue when pulling your hot (body) car in.

I had a similar experience a long time ago with...

I had a similar experience a long time ago with my tripower. I bought the Phenolic spacer kit for the carbs from John@Pontiactripower.com. Problem went away.
